Why look beyond InVideo AI?

InVideo AI is a text-to-video platform that charges credits when you generate a video preview, not when you download. Users report losing 50-67% of their monthly credits on a single test video, with no refunds issued after any credit consumption.

  • Credits consumed before download — preview generation burns credits immediately
  • Test videos drain monthly allowance — single video can cost 50+ credits (50-67% of plan)
  • No refunds after credit use — support denies refunds once any credits are consumed
  • Pricing: $17-170/mo with no truly free video plan

2

Pictory

Pictory converts scripts and articles into videos with automatic scene selection and voiceover. Credits are consumed on export, not preview, giving you more control than InVideo. However, annual plans are non-refundable and the platform lacks AI image generation capabilities.

Pros

  • Credits charged on export, not preview generation
  • Automatic scene matching from stock footage
  • Text-to-video from blog posts and articles

Cons

  • Minimum $25/mo with no free video plan
  • Annual plans non-refundable regardless of issues
Pricing: Standard $25/mo | Premium $49/mo (annual plans available)Best for: Repurposing long-form content into video with export-based credit system
3

Lumen5

Lumen5 uses a slide-based editor for text-to-video creation with stock media library access. The platform shows credit usage before finalizing, unlike InVideo's preview-burns-credits model. Free tier exists but adds "Lumen5 branding" watermark to all exports.

Pros

  • Slide-by-slide editor with more granular control
  • Credits consumed on final render, not preview
  • Large stock media library included

Cons

  • Outdated interface and workflow compared to AI-first tools
  • Watermark on free plan exports
Pricing: Basic $29/mo | Starter $79/mo | Professional $199/moBest for: Teams needing manual control over slide-based video assembly
4

Fliki

Fliki generates videos from text with AI voices and stock footage. Credit system is more transparent than InVideo, charging on final download rather than preview. However, users report 4+ day support response times and refund denials when service quality fails.

Pros

  • Credits charged on download, not generation preview
  • 70+ AI voices across multiple languages
  • Text-to-video and blog-to-video conversion

Cons

  • Watermark on free plan videos
  • Poor support (4+ day response times) and refund denials reported
Pricing: Free (watermark) | Standard $28/mo | Premium $88/moBest for: Multilingual video creation with download-based credit usage
5

Synthesia

Synthesia creates videos with AI avatars and no credit confusion — flat monthly video limits instead of credit burns. Enterprise-focused with professional avatars and custom templates. High price point makes it less accessible for individual creators or small teams testing video content.

Pros

  • No credit system — fixed video limits per month
  • Professional AI avatars and presenters
  • Enterprise-grade features and support

Cons

  • Starts at $29/mo for very limited videos (10/mo on Starter)
  • No free plan or trial without sales contact
Pricing: Starter $29/mo (10 videos) | Creator $89/mo | Enterprise (custom)Best for: Enterprise teams needing avatar-based videos with predictable monthly limits
